Cultural Significance
White tigers hold a prominent place in various cultures. In Chinese mythology, white tigers symbolize strength and bravery, often associated with the West and the element of metal. In ancient India, they are seen as sacred, representing beauty and power. In modern media, white tigers serve as icons of the exotic, captivating audiences worldwide. Hinduism
In Hinduism, the white tiger embodies power and divinity. It often symbolizes strength and is associated with the goddess Durga, who rides a tiger into battle. This connection emphasizes the interplay of fierce strength and nurturing qualities. Chinese Zodiac
In the Chinese Zodiac, the white tiger is a symbol of strength and bravery. Those born in the Year of the Tiger are believed to possess these traits, embodying confidence and charisma. The white tiger specifically represents the element of metal, which ties to resilience and determination.
